Не изменяем имена файлов картинок товара при загрузке (VAMshop)
30.06.2010 | Написав eugenem
По умолчанию имена файлов картинок при загрузке меняются на вида “ID_товара_№картинки”. В общем-то это довольно удобно, но если по тем, или иным причинам Вы хотите оставить имя файла без изменений, то открываем файл admin/includes/classes/categories.php, находим строчку:
$products_image_name = strtolower($products_id.'_0.'.$nsuffix); |
и меняем на:
$products_image_name = strtolower($products_image->filename); |
Эта правка работает для основной картинки товара. Для того, чтобы не изменялись названия дополнительных картинок, ниже находим:
$products_image_name = strtolower($products_id.'_'. ($img +1).'.'.$nsuffix); |
и меняем на:
$products_image_name = strtolower(($img +1).'.'.$pIMG->filename); |
В результате имя допкартинки меняться тоже не будет. Правда, тут не все идеально, впереди будет прибавлен номер этой картинки по порядку.
Рубрика: Веброзробка
1 коментарій читачів статті "Не изменяем имена файлов картинок товара при загрузке (VAMshop)"
-
пишет:Илья
Спасибо!
как раз сегодня об этом задумался